How somatic and talking approaches work online
Janet combines somatic-informed work with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) and Attachment-Based ideas to help people online. Somatic work asks clients to notice bodily sensations and breathing to reduce tension and anchored stress, which can help with anxiety, panic and sleeping problems.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) focuses on values and practical action - it helps people accept difficult thoughts while committing to small, goal-driven steps. Attachment-Based Therapy looks at patterns in relationships and helps people understand how early connections shape reactions and closeness in adult life.Finding the right mix of approaches is part of the process. Janet will work together with each person to decide which methods fit their needs, goals and preferences. That collaborative planning helps tailor sessions so they feel relevant and useful from the start.
Online therapy offers flexibility through video calls, phone sessions, live chat or text messaging. These options make it easier to fit therapy around work, family or different time zones. People can choose a format that suits how they prefer to communicate, and Janet will adapt exercises and somatic practices for use in each online medium.
